16.07.27 (UI) - सार्वजनिक क्लाउड के रिलीज़ नोट के लिए Apigee Edge

आपको Apigee Edge का दस्तावेज़ दिख रहा है.
Apigee X के दस्तावेज़ पर जाएं.
जानकारी

हमने बुधवार, 27 जुलाई, 2016 को Apigee Edge for Public Cloud का नया वर्शन रिलीज़ किया था.

नई सुविधाएं और अपडेट

इस रिलीज़ में नई सुविधाएं और अपडेट शामिल किए गए हैं. इनके बारे में यहां बताया गया है.

प्रॉक्सी विज़र्ड का इस्तेमाल करते समय, SOAP प्रॉक्सी का व्यवहार

प्रॉक्सी विज़र्ड का इस्तेमाल करके, WSDL से SOAP पर आधारित प्रॉक्सी बनाते समय, प्रॉक्सी बनाने के दो विकल्प होते हैं:

  • पास-थ्रू एसओएपी, जिसमें प्रॉक्सी, एसओएपी अनुरोध के पेलोड को बिना किसी बदलाव के पास कर देती है.
  • REST से SOAP से REST, जहां प्रॉक्सी, JSON जैसे इनकमिंग पेलोड को SOAP पेलोड में बदलता है. इसके बाद, SOAP रिस्पॉन्स को उस फ़ॉर्मैट में वापस बदलता है जिसकी उम्मीद कॉलर को होती है.

इस रिलीज़ में, इन विकल्पों के काम करने के तरीके से जुड़े ये अपडेट शामिल हैं. पुराने और नए वर्शन के बीच अंतर, उन नीतियों और कॉन्फ़िगरेशन में है जो प्रॉक्सी विज़र्ड अपने-आप जनरेट करता है.

पास-थ्रू एसओएपी

  • अब सभी WSDL कार्रवाइयां, प्रॉक्सी रिसॉर्स (जैसे कि "/cityforecastbyzip") के बजाय प्रॉक्सी बेस पाथ "/" पर भेजी जाती हैं. कार्रवाई के नाम, टारगेट SOAP सेवा को भेजे जाते हैं. यह तरीका, SOAP स्पेसिफ़िकेशन से मेल खाता है.

  • जनरेट की गई प्रॉक्सी, अब अनुरोध में JSON फ़ॉर्मैट का इस्तेमाल नहीं करती. यह सिर्फ़ एक्सएमएल फ़ॉर्मैट में काम करता है. प्रॉक्सी यह पक्का करती है कि SOAP अनुरोधों में Envelope, Body, और http://schemas.xmlsoap.org/soap/envelope/ नेमस्पेस मौजूद हो.

REST से SOAP से REST

  • प्रॉक्सी अब WSDL RPC के साथ काम नहीं करती. सिर्फ़ Document/Literal के साथ काम करती है. इसकी जांच WSDL 2.0 के साथ नहीं की गई है.
  • WS-Policy के साथ नए व्यवहार की जांच नहीं की गई है.
  • प्रॉक्सी की मदद से, FormParams के बजाय JSON डेटा पोस्ट किया जा सकता है.
  • प्रॉक्सी बिल्डर का इस्तेमाल करके, प्रॉक्सी में सीओआरएस (क्रॉस-ऑरिजिन रिसॉर्स शेयरिंग) की सुविधा जोड़ने पर, आपको ये बेहतर सुविधाएं दिखेंगी:
    • Access-Control-Allow-Headers हेडर: Origin, x-requested-with, और Accept हेडर के अलावा, Access-Control-Allow-Headers हेडर में Content-Type, Accept-Encoding, Accept-Language, Host, Pragma, Referrer, User-Agent, और Cache-Control भी शामिल हैं.
    • Access-Control-Allow-Methods हेडर: GET, PUT, POST, DELETE के अलावा, इस हेडर में PATCH और OPTIONS वर्ब भी शामिल होते हैं.
  • किसी WSDL के लिए एपीआई प्रॉक्सी जनरेट करते समय, Edge उन सभी ComplexTypes को पढ़ता है जिन्हें WSDL में abstract के तौर पर तय किया गया है. साथ ही, यह उन सभी इंस्टेंस टाइप को सही तरीके से पहचानता है जो abstract टाइप पर आधारित होते हैं.

wsdl2apigee ओपन सोर्स कमांड-लाइन यूटिलिटी

Apigee, WSDL से पासथ्रू या रेस्ट-टू-सोप एपीआई प्रॉक्सी जनरेट करने के लिए, ओपन सोर्स कमांड-लाइन सुविधा भी उपलब्ध कराता है. https://github.com/apigee/wsdl2apigee पर जाएं.

(EDGEUI-614)

गड़बड़ियां ठीक की गईं

इस रिलीज़ में इन बग को ठीक किया गया है. यह सूची मुख्य रूप से उन उपयोगकर्ताओं के लिए है जो यह देखना चाहते हैं कि उनके सहायता टिकट ठीक किए गए हैं या नहीं. इसे सभी उपयोगकर्ताओं के लिए, ज़्यादा जानकारी देने के लिए डिज़ाइन नहीं किया गया है.

समस्या आईडी ब्यौरा
EDGEUI-621 'नई एपीआई प्रॉक्सी के तौर पर सेव करें' सुविधा, डिफ़ॉल्ट नाम का इस्तेमाल करती है. इसमें साइंटिफ़िक नोटेशन शामिल होता है. जैसे, "new-1.234568901234568e+53"
EDGEUI-572 यूज़र इंटरफ़ेस (यूआई) पर "गड़बड़ी: सेशन टाइम आउट" के बजाय "गड़बड़ी: अज्ञात गड़बड़ी" दिखती है